PEOPLE v. HERNANDEZ, B145238
Because record did not support the existence of good cause to remove a juror, who, having heard nearly all the evidence, was sympathetic to the defense, appellant was denied a trial by a fair and impartial jury; thus, conviction reversed, and double jeopardy bars retrial.
